Public bug reported:
Binary package hint: nvidia-common
If you use the proprietary nvidia drivers and you have manually
installed the PAE kernel (for example to make use of >4GB of RAM),
upgrading the nvidia drivers will cause the boot to hang.
The problem is that the nvidia-current package depe

Best solution may be to make nvidia-current depend on a virtual package
for kernel headers and have *that* package depend on all of:
linux-headers
linux-headers-generic
linux-headers-generic-pae
